1994 e320 half shaft torque numbers?
 
I'm changing the half shafts and i need to know torque numbers for the 6 bolts per side connection to the differental. also i found something on line for the large bolt on the wheel hub, it said 200 newton meters, woulden't that be over 1000 psi?

Ferdman 07-19-2016 11:59 AM

It would equate to about 148 ft/lbs. You are confusing a pressure measurement (psi) with a torque measurement (ft/lbs or NM).

1994 e320 half shaft torque values
 
oh, duh...do you know what the torque numbers are for the 12 -10mm bolts that attach the 1/2 shaft to the diff.?

Frank Reiner 07-19-2016 02:56 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by stumpedhans (Post 3617267)
oh, duh...do you know what the torque numbers are for the 12 -10mm bolts that attach the 1/2 shaft to the diff.?

70Nm/52lb.-ft.
